Abstract :
Describe a PID auto-tuning algorithm based on relay feedback. By placing test signals on the process to make it surge stably and continuously, we can obtain the process data with which to calculate the critical gain and critical surge period, then proper PID parameters can be computed with the improved Ziegler-Nichols formula. Some software based on this algorithm has run successfully on some large industrial equipment for over 7 years
